                The first two links are different outlets reporting on the exact same study, which talks about a nationwide increase in death rates, not just California, and both have this quote from the study author early in the article:

                Some of the increase in the mortality rate may be attributable to county death records keeping better track of who is homeless, Fowle said. Other than that, he and his team aren’t sure what else is behind the rising death rates — more research is needed, he said.

                The third link is entirely about efforts to have better reporting, in order to figure out what policies might help. It has no policy recommendations or criticisms of current policy.

                The fourth and fifth links are about suicide rates among transgender people nationally, not specific to California.

                I am not tracking how any of these reflect on specific policies advocated for by Newsom.
